云上布局:Windows运行库优化之道
|
2026AI模拟图,仅供参考 在现代Windows系统中,运行库作为应用程序与操作系统之间的桥梁,承载着大量基础功能的调用。无论是程序启动、图形渲染还是网络通信,都依赖于这些底层库的稳定与高效。然而,随着软件复杂度提升,运行库管理不当常导致性能下降、兼容性问题甚至系统崩溃。如何实现“云上布局”,让运行库真正服务于应用而非拖累系统,成为开发者与运维者必须面对的关键课题。所谓“云上布局”,并非单纯指将运行库部署到云端,而是强调通过现代化架构思维对运行库进行分层、隔离与动态管理。传统方式下,多个应用程序共享同一套运行库,容易引发“DLL地狱”——版本冲突、依赖缺失或覆盖问题频发。而采用云原生理念,可将运行库以容器化形式封装,每个应用独立携带所需版本,避免污染全局环境,实现真正的轻量级部署。 在实际操作中,可通过工具链如Visual Studio的打包机制或第三方方案(如vcpkg、Conan)实现运行库的精准依赖管理。这些工具能自动解析依赖关系,下载指定版本,并在构建阶段完成静态链接或私有部署,使应用具备自包含特性。这不仅提升了部署灵活性,也显著降低了跨平台迁移的难度。 借助云平台提供的自动化部署能力,运行库的更新与维护也可实现无缝集成。例如,通过CI/CD流水线,在每次构建时自动验证运行库版本兼容性,结合灰度发布策略逐步上线,有效降低因库更新引发的系统风险。同时,利用日志监控与异常追踪系统,可快速定位由运行库引起的性能瓶颈或崩溃事件,实现主动优化。 更进一步,对于大型分布式系统,可将通用运行库抽象为微服务化的组件,按需加载并缓存于边缘节点。用户请求时,仅在需要时拉取特定库模块,减少初始资源占用,提升响应速度。这种“按需加载”的模式,正是云上布局的核心思想:不再追求全量安装,而是以智能调度替代冗余部署。 最终,运行库不再是系统的负担,而成为可伸缩、可管理的基础设施资产。通过云上布局,我们重新定义了运行库的价值——它不再只是代码的附属品,而是支撑应用敏捷演进与高可用运行的关键引擎。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

